Not to say that I don't enjoy talking electric guitars, but I probably put in just as many hours on my acoustic. Here's what I'm currently playing on:

It's a Tanglewood TW-133. I got this guitar following an unhealthy obsession with getting my mitts on a Martin 000-15M. I played one a couple of years ago in a guitar shop in Berlin & completely fell in love with it. After coming to the conclusion that my guitar skills at present don't justify spending that much on an acoustic, I started looking around at alternatives. Whilst I'm not going to make any bold claims about the Tanglewood being as good a guitar, it cost a fraction of the price & retains a lot of the tonal characteristics that made me love that Martin so much. I'm using Elixir Nanoweb 12s on it, which sound great to these ears & it's pretty much exclusively tuned to DADGAD.
